美韩联合军事演习12天

Tensions refuse to go away

THE Republic of Korea (ROK) and the United States began annual joint militaryexercises on Monday despite strong opposition from the Democratic People's Republic of Korea (DPRK).

According to the Chosun Daily, 26,000 US troops and over 50,000 ROK troops will participate in the joint exercises, named Key Resolve and Foal Eagle, which are set to end on March 20.

Its stated purpose is to strengthen the ability of the allies to reinforcefrontline forces if ROK is invaded.

The DPRK military has demanded that the US military cancel the exercises.

A DPRK general staff spokesman said Monday that his country would retaliate against any attempt to intercepta planned rocket launch by mobilizing "powerful military means". It said any attenpt would "mean a war," the ROK's Yonhap News Agency reported Monday.

Exercise

The US is using 14,000 troops from overseas bases, it said earlier. There are about 28,500 US troops currently stationed in South Korea.

The aircraft carrier USS John C. Stennis and seven Aegis-class destroyers will take part in the exercises, the Chosun Daily said.

Tough talk on the Korean Peninsula

Tensions on the Korean Peninsula have always existed. Now Pyongyang has blamed worsening relations on the anti-DPRK policy adopted by Lee Myung-bak, president of the Republic of Korea.

The two Koreas made strides toward reconciliation, holding the first summit in 2000 and reconnecting transportation routes across their frontier.

But those improving relations have taken a turn since the conservative Lee took office last year. Lee pledged to get tough with Pyongyang and ended aid to the DPRK while referring to it as the "main threat". This led the north to rule out any possibility of talks with the south.

The DPRK's plan to launch a satellite stoked tensions on the peninsula as well. It said that, as a state, it had the right to test fire a missile as part of its peaceful space program. But the US and ROK claim that it was a long-range missile it was launching, in violation of UN resolution and that they would intercept the missile if it posed a threat.

Analysts said DPRK may adopt the current tough stand to press the Obama administration to clarify its policy toward the country.
